Masutatsu Oyama, a Karate Master standing at the very pinnacle of today's Karate world, developed the Kyokushin system — making available to everyone the essence of his thirty years of Karate study and training. Kyokushin (meaning "Ultimate Truth") was formally founded in 1964 with the establishment of the International Karate Organization (IKO).

Oyama Karate begins and ends with points and circles, in which lie the miraculous strength and the life of the system. Grounded in Zen and Shinto psychology, the Kyokushin system is serene in movement, refined and stable in form. It is the authentic method of Kyokushin Karate — a discipline that builds not only physical strength but also character, humility, and an unbreakable spirit.

Today, IKO Kyokushinkaikan is one of the largest martial arts organizations in the world, with over 15 million practitioners across 167 countries, all united by the spirit of Osu and the pursuit of the ultimate truth.
